    Wi-Fi Radio

    Radio design

    Tri-radio and up to eight spatial streams:
    Radio 1: 2.4GHz: Two spatial streams, 2x2 MU-MIMO
    Radio 2: 5GHz: Two spatial streams, 2x2 MU-MIMO
    Radio 3: 6GHz: Four spatial streams, 4x4 MU-MIMO

    Operating frequencies

    Radio 1: 802.11b/g/n/ax
    2.400 GHz to 2.483 GHz, channels 1 to 13

    Radio 2: 802.11a/n/ac/ax
    5.150 GHz to 5.250 GHz, U-NII-1, channels 36, 40, 44, and 48
    5.250 GHz to 5.350 GHz, U-NII-2A, channels 52, 56, 60, and 64
    5.470 GHz to 5.725 GHz, U-NII-2C, channels 100, 104, 108, 112, 116, 120, 124, 128, 132, 136, and 140
    5.725 GHz to 5.850 GHz, U-NII-3/ISM, channels 149, 153, 157, 161, and 165

    Radio 3: 802.11ax
    5.925 GHz to 7.125 GHz, U-NII-4, channels 1 to 233

    Note: Available frequency bands may vary with countries or regions. To use the above-mentioned frequency bands, ensure that they are supported in your country or region. For details, see WLAN Country or Region Codes and Channel Compliance.

    Data rates

    Combined peak data rate: 7.780 Gbps

    Radio 1: 2.4 GHz, 574 Mbps
    Two spatial stream Single User (SU) MIMO for up to 574 Mbps wireless data rate to 2SS HE40 802.11ax client devices (maximum)
    Two spatial stream Single User (SU) MIMO for up to 287 Mbps wireless data rate to 2SS HE20 802.11ax client devices (typical)

    Radio 2: 5 GHz, 2.402 Gbps
    Two spatial stream Single User (SU) MIMO for up to 2.402 Gbps wireless data rate to individual 4SS HE160 802.11ax client devices (maximum)
    Two spatial stream Single User (SU) MIMO for up to 1.201 Gbps wireless data rate to individual 2SS HE80 802.11ax client devices (typical)

    Radio 3: 6 GHz, 4.804 Gbps
    Four spatial stream Single User (SU) MIMO for up to 4.804 Gbps wireless data rate to individual 4SS HE160 802.11ax client devices (maximum)
    Two spatial stream Single User (SU) MIMO for up to 1.201 Gbps wireless data rate to individual 2SS HE80 802.11ax client devices (typical)
    Four spatial stream Multi User (MU) MIMO for up to 4.804 Gbps wireless data rate to up to four 1SS or two 2SS HE160 802.11ax DL-MU-MIMO capable client devices simultaneously (maximum)
    Four spatial stream Multi User (MU) MIMO for up to 2.402 Gbps wireless data rate to up to four 1SS or two 2SS HE80 802.11ax DL-MU-MIMO capable client devices simultaneously (typical)

    Data rate set

    The following 802.11-compliant data rates in Mbps are supported

    2.4 GHz
    802.11b: 1, 2, 5.5, 11
    802.11g: 1, 2, 5.5, 6, 9, 11, 12, 18, 24, 36, 48, 54
    802.11n: 6.5 to 300 (MCS0 to MCS15, HT20 to HT40)
    802.11ax: 8.6 to 574 (MCS0 to MCS11, NSS = 1 to 2, HE20 to HE40)

    5 GHz
    802.11a: 6, 9, 12, 18, 24, 36, 48, 54
    802.11n: 6.5 to 300 (MCS0 to MVC31, HT20 to HT40)
    802.11ac: 6.5 to 1,733 (MCS0 to MCS9, NSS = 1 to 4, VHT20 to VHT160)
    802.11ax: 8.6 to 2,402 (MCS0 to MCS11, NSS = 1 to 4, HE20 to HE160)

    6 GHz
    802.11ax:8.6 ~ 4,804 (MCS0 ~ MCS11, NSS = 1 to 4, HE20 to HE160)

    Packet aggregation

    802.11n/ac/ax: A-MPDU and A-MSDU

    Antenna type

    Built-in omnidirectional antennas (two 2.4 GHz antennas, two 5 GHz antennas and four 6 GHz antennas)

    Antenna gain

    2.4 GHz: 5 dBi
    5 GHz: 5 dBi
    6 GHz: 5 dBi

    Maximum transmit power

    2.4 GHz: 27 dBm (24dBm per chain)
    5 GHz: 26 dBm (23dBm per chain)
    6 GHz: 26 dBm (23dBm per chain)

    Note: The transmit power is limited by local regulatory requirements. For details, see WLAN Country or Region Codes and Channel Compliance.

    Thailand
    2.400 GHz to 2.4835 GHz, EIRP ≤ 20 dBm
    5.150 GHz to 5.350 GHz, EIRP ≤ 23 dBm
    5.470 GHz to 5.725 GHz, EIRP ≤ 30 dBm
    5.725 GHz to 5.825 GHz, EIRP ≤ 30 dBm
    5.945 GHz to 6.425 GHz, EIRP ≤ 23 dBm

    Power increment

    Configurable in increments of 1 dBm

    Radio technologies

    802.11b: Direct-Sequence Spread-Spectrum (DSSS)
    802.11a/g/n/ac: Orthogonal Frequency-Division Multiplexing (OFDM)
    802.11ax: Orthogonal Frequency Division Multiple Access (OFDMA)

    Modulation types

    802.11b: BPSK, QPSK, and CCK
    802.11a/g/n: BPSK, QPSK, 16-QAM, and 64-QAM
    802.11ac: BPSK, QPSK, 16-QAM, 64-QAM, and 256-QAM
    802.11ax: BPSK, QPSK, 16-QAM, 64-QAM, 256-QAM, and 1024-QAM

    Power Supply and Consumption

    Input power supply

    The AP supports the following two power supply modes:
    54 V DC/1.1 A power input over DC connector: The DC connector accepts 2.1 mm/5.5 mm center-positive circular plug. A DC power adapter is delivered with the main unit.

    PoE input over LAN 1: The power source equipment (PSE) complies with IEEE 802.3af/at/bt standard (PoE/PoE+/PoE++).

    Note:
    If both DC power and PoE are available, DC power is preferred.
    When powered by 802.3bt (PoE++), the AP operates with the optimal performance.
    When powered by 802.3at (PoE+), the AP starts up normally. LAN 2 and USB port cannot supply power to external devices.
    When powered by 802.3af (PoE), the AP starts up normally. 2.4 GHz, 5 GHz and 6 GHz radio cards can work only in one spatial stream mode . LAN 2 and USB port cannot supply power to external devices.

    PoE port

    When powered by 802.3bt (PoE++), the LAN 2 port can source 48 V/12.95 W power to an IoT unit.

    USB port

    When powered by 802.3bt (PoE++), the USB port can source 1 A/5 W power to an attached device.

    Overall power consumption

    Maximum power consumption: 40 W
    DC powered: 40 W
    PoE powered (802.3af): 12.95 W
    PoE+ powered (802.3at): 23 W
    PoE++ powered (802.3bt): 40 W
    Idle mode: 10.3 W
